DIRECTING THE DEPARTMENT OF LABOR TO STUDY THE CREATION OF A DELAWARE HEALTHCARE APPRENTICESHIP DEGREE PROGRAM AND TO REPORT FINDINGS AND RECOMMENDATIONS TO THE GOVERNOR AND THE GENERAL ASSEMBLY.

Summary

This resolution directs the Delaware Department of Labor to study the feasibility of creating a Healthcare Apprenticeship Degree Program. It aims to explore new ways to train healthcare workers through earn-and-learn models, which could help address staffing shortages in the state's healthcare sector. The Department will report its findings and recommendations to the Governor and General Assembly.
